Enhanced reliability optimisation using Levy Flight-Assisted Salp Swarm and Grey Wolf Hybridisation with physics-informed neural surrogates

Reliability-redundancy optimisation aims to design a cost-effective, highly reliable system by determining the optimal level of active redundancy for complex systems composed of non-repairable components. This study presents a robust hybrid framework for ...
